SB 594: Veterans' Homes
GENERAL BILL by Brown-Waite
Veterans' Homes; includes extended congregate care in types of care offered by domiciliary home; revises prerequisites to eligibility for admission to domiciliary home; conforms cross-reference; replaces term "member" with term "resident"; revises list of information about each resident which is to be kept in general register; amends residency requirement for admission into Veterans' Nursing Home of Florida, etc. Amends Ch. 296.
Last Action: 4/2/1998 Senate - Placed on Special Order Calendar -SJ 00343; Read second time -SJ 00371; Amendment(s) adopted -SJ 00371; House Bill substituted -SJ 00371; Laid on Table, Iden./Sim./Compare Bill(s) passed, refer to HB 1649 (Ch. 98-16)

Identical bill
Companion bills that are identical word-for-word, not including titles. However, Resolutions and Concurrent Resolutions are considered identical if the only difference is the word "House" or "Senate."
Similar bill
Companion bills that are substantially similar in text or have substantial portions of text that are largely the same.
Compare bill
Bills that have selected provisions that are similar in text.
Linked bill
A bill that is contingent upon passage of another bill within the same chamber, e.g., a trust fund bill, a bill providing a public record exemption, or an implementing bill.
